Suddenly he threw back his head and laughed; then almost unconsciously
he stretched out his arms to the setting sun.
"Thank you," he cried, and with a swift whirring of wings two grouse
rose near by and shot like brown streaks over the silver tarn. "Sooner
or later the mist always goes. . . ."
He tapped out the ashes of his pipe, and put it back in his pocket.
And as he straightened himself up, of a sudden it seemed to the man
that the mountains and the moors, the tarn and the bogland approved of
the change in him, and, finding him worthy, told him their message.
"The Sun will always triumph," they cried in a mighty chorus. "Sooner
or later the mist will always go."
For a space the man stood there, while the sun, sinking lower and
lower, bathed the world in glory. Then, he whistled. . . .
"Your last walk on the moors, Binks, old man, so come on. To-morrow we
go back."
And with a terrier scurrying madly through the heather around him, the
man strode forward.
